RE: The tariff classification of a polyurethane plastics coated textile fabric, for use in shoe insoles, from China.

Dear Ms. Moore:

In your letter dated January 24, 2006, on behalf of H.H. Brown Shoe Technologies, you requested a tariff classification ruling.

The instant sample, consists of a 100% polyester knit fabric, which has been laminated on one side to a rather substantial layer of polyurethane plastics foam material. While no respective weights were provided, this PU plastics portion appears to be well over 70 percent, by weight, of the total weight of the material. Noting that the knit textile layer will likely be the outer or wear portion, when utilized as a shoe insole and, as such, will assist in comfort and sweat absorption, it is considered to be more than mere reinforcement.

The applicable subheading for the material, which we presume, will be imported as roll goods, will be 5903.20.2000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for textile fabrics impregnated, coated, covered or laminated with plastics, with polyurethane, of man-made fibers, over 70 percent by weight of rubber or plastics. The duty rate is Free. Duty rates are provided for your convenience and are subject to change.
